Application Progress of Magnetic Solid-Phase Extraction for Heavy Metal Analysis in Food: A Mini Review

The emerging sample pretreatment technique of magnetic solid-phase extraction (MSPE) has drawn the researchers’ attention for the advantages of less reagent consumption, fast separation/enrichment process, high adsorption capacity, and simple operation. This paper presents a review of synthesis techniques, classification, and analysis procedures for MSPE in the detection of heavy metals in food. The application of magnetic adsorbents derived from silica, metal oxides, carbon, polymers, etc., has been used for the detection of heavy metals in food. Then the recent development of the technology of MSPE for the analysis of heavy metals extraction in food is summarized in detail. Finally, the future outlook for the improvement of MSPE is also discussed.
